Course Lessons

  • Lesson 1. The Dynamics of Conflict: Diverse Types and Effective Strategies

    Conflict, stemming from disagreements over wants, goals, or principles, can be seen in various forms across personal and organizational spheres. By embracing strategies such as collaboration and emotional intelligence, one can transform conflicts into constructive opportunities.
  • Lesson 2. Conflict Communication: Navigating Barriers to Achieve Understanding

    Assertive communication, balancing respect and clarity, transforms challenging conversations into arenas for mutual benefit. By employing techniques like 'I' statements and active listening, conflicts can metamorphose into collaborative dialogues driving collective progress.
  • Lesson 3. Harnessing Emotional Intelligence for Conflict Management

    Understanding internal conflict, rooted in personal values and cognitive dissonance, is key to effective conflict resolution, requiring a deep dive into the psychological tug-of-war between competing desires, beliefs, or values. By exploring these intricate dynamics, individuals gain insights into human behavior, enhancing their ability to navigate negotiations appropriately.
  • Lesson 4. Resolution Beyond Conflict: Understanding Mediation's Transformative Power

    Mediation positively impacts societal interactions by teaching collaborative dispute resolution skills and reducing reliance on adversarial legal systems. As students and community members engage in mediation, they promote a culture of cooperative communication, enhancing social harmony and understanding.
  • Lesson 5. Mastering Negotiation Through Empathy and Active Listening

    Interest-Based Negotiation (IBN) steers negotiations away from adversarial positions towards understanding underlying interests, fostering empathetic and cooperative problem-solving. This approach not only increases the likelihood of mutually beneficial outcomes but also builds lasting relationships founded on trust and respect.
  • Lesson 6. Exploring the Roots of Emotional Reactions: Navigating Triggers in Conflict Situations

    Through empathy and active listening, Alex and Jamie resolve disagreements by valuing each other's perspectives, fostering a collaborative environment. These techniques build trust and mutual respect while allowing individuals to turn conflicts into opportunities for deeper understanding.
  • Lesson 7. Navigating Global Conflicts: The Role of Cultural Norms and Values

    Cultural norms are hidden forces governing societal interactions, influencing communication, problem-solving, and perceptions of time, which vary significantly between cultures. Appreciating these norms can forestall conflicts and frustrations, allowing for smoother negotiations across cultural divides.
  • Lesson 8. Breaking Down Digital Disputes: A Guide

    The digital nature of virtual teams often leads to breakdowns in communication due to lack of non-verbal cues and diverse cultural interpretations, increasing the potential for conflicts. Proactively addressing these by incorporating flexible communication strategies and cultural sensitivity training fosters a more trusting and harmonious team dynamic.
  • Lesson 9. Listening Actively for Better Negotiation Outcomes

    Through active listening, speakers not only feel heard but valued, fostering an environment ripe for collaboration and mutual respect. By mastering this approach, individuals can transform contentious interactions into constructive dialogues that promote growth and connection.
  • Lesson 10. Influence and Authority: Navigating Power in Corporate Life

    Redistributing power through cross-departmental teams fosters synergy and efficiency by balancing influence and promoting dynamic idea sharing. Leaders can leverage power to drive innovation, setting the stage for collaborative success across the organization.
  • Lesson 11. The Art of Win-Win: Transforming Conflict through Collaboration

    Win-win negotiation emphasizes collaborative problem-solving, ensuring all parties achieve their goals while fostering mutual respect and trust. By focusing on shared interests rather than rigid positions, negotiators can create more sustainable and satisfying agreements.
  • Lesson 12. Mindfulness and Emotional Control in Conflict Resolution

    Choosing calm and rational strategies over automatic fight-or-flight reactions can turn potential conflicts into opportunities for cooperation. Through empathy and active listening, parties can engage in meaningful dialogue, easing tensions and fostering mutual respect.
  • Lesson 13. Navigating Cultural Sensitivity in Negotiation Ethics

    Embracing integrity and fairness in negotiation fosters trust, leading to long-lasting partnerships and successful outcomes. These principles not only improve the negotiation process but also contribute towards achieving broader societal and organizational goals.
  • Lesson 14. Confronting the Invisible: Identifying and Overcoming Personal Bias in Negotiation

    Personal biases are ingrained psychological tendencies influencing our judgments and interactions, potentially leading to skewed negotiation outcomes. Overcoming these biases through mindfulness, diverse teams, and structured decision-making can lead to more balanced and effective conflict resolutions.
  • Lesson 15. The Art of Effective Communication in Diverse Teams

    In cross-functional settings, conflicts are inevitable but can be constructive when approached with a mindset that embraces diversity and collaboration. By employing tools and practices that foster open communication and harness the team's collective strengths, conflicts are transformed into catalysts for shared success and sustained performance.
 

Learning Outcomes

By successfully completing this course, students will be able to:
  • Define the different types of conflict, such as intrapersonal, interpersonal, intragroup, and intergroup, and explain their potential for growth and innovation.
  • Demonstrate effective conflict resolution strategies, such as active listening and collaborative problem-solving, that transform conflict into opportunities for collective advancement.
  • Identify the impact of different types of conflicts on personal and organizational growth through analysis of real-world examples.
  • Define and describe strategies to overcome emotional, language, and perceptual barriers in conflict communication.
  • Identify and apply active listening and empathy techniques to effectively resolve conflicts and facilitate dialogue.
  • Demonstrate effective communication techniques to resolve misunderstandings and promote inclusive dialogue in diverse teams.
  • Demonstrate effective communication skills by employing active listening and cultural sensitivity to bridge misunderstandings during interpersonal and organizational interactions.
  • Recognize and describe the impact of cognitive dissonance on personal decision-making and interpersonal relationships.
  • Recognize indicators of cognitive dissonance in conflict scenarios and apply emotional intelligence strategies to resolve internal conflicts effectively.
  • Describe the ways in which mediation has been successfully applied across various disciplines, such as education, international diplomacy, and healthcare, and analyze their impacts on conflict resolution.
  • Identify and examine the key roles and skills of a mediator in facilitating effective communication and resolution among conflicting parties while ensuring emotional and cultural sensitivities are respected.
  • Demonstrate the use of mindfulness and visualization techniques to manage emotional reactions during conflict situations.
  • Identify personal emotional triggers in conflict situations and describe how past experiences contribute to these triggers.
  • Demonstrate mastery of lesson content at levels of 70% or higher.
